Output f39ae50624ed531e97dbaab49b5072ba66aa221590ca50c1ec067ae71fe253ef:631

value
18666
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e5135031cdcdd5b65e14a632e34c0d27ed2e0b84bd7e77ca47be8f47939d1521
address
bc1pu5f4qvwdeh2mvhs55cewxnqdylkjuzuyh4l80jj8h6850yuaz5ssdx0pz4
transaction
f39ae50624ed531e97dbaab49b5072ba66aa221590ca50c1ec067ae71fe253ef
spent
true